Italian Sommeliers Admit Pope Into Their Ranks |
Rumours in the Vatican indicate that the Italian Sommelier Association (AIS), Rome, has made Pope Benedict XVI an 'Honorary Sommelier'. It appears that the pontiff received the silver tastevin, the classic symbol of recognition for a sommelier, reports WineNews.it. ... more |

Heineken's Singapore Partner Enters India's Biggest Beer Market |
Asia Pacific Breweries has expanded further into India with a joint venture in Andhra Pradesh, the country's largest beer market. The Singapore-based brewer, in which Heineken owns a 42% stake, announced a deal to build a greenfield brewery just outside ... more |
Carrefour Eyes Cash-And-Carry, Franchisee Formats in India |
The world's second largest retail chain Carrefour is exploring a number of formats to establish a presence in the booming Indian market, reports The Economic Times. "India is an attractive market. We are definitely going to be here," said an official from Carrefour India . ... more |
